Can pushing a car help start it?

By pushing or letting the vehicle roll downhill then engaging the clutch at the appropriate speed the engine will turn over and start. The technique is most commonly employed when other starting methods (automobile self starter, kick start, jump start etc.)

Can pushing a car charge the battery?

You can push start the car, but you can't charge the battery directly by pushing. There is no physical connection from the wheels to the alternator without going through the engine (wheels->drive shaft->gearbox->clutch->flywheel->crankshaft->serpentine or alternator belt->alternator).

What law of motion is pushing a car?

1. Pushing a Car and a Truck. Newton's second law of motion can be observed by comparing the acceleration produced in a car and a truck after applying an equal magnitude of force to both. It is easy to notice that after pushing a car and a truck with the same intensity, the car accelerates more than the truck.

What happens when we push start the car?

To push start a car, you have to get the engine spinning. Start with the car in gear and then push the car to move the tires, which will cause the engine to rotate. When the engine spins fast enough, just like on an airplane, it'll run by itself.

Why is pushing safer than pulling?

Push over pull. If at all possible, pushing an object is safer than pulling. Pushing involves fewer muscles in the lower back and provides better visibility for workers. ... Use transport devices, such as hand trucks or pallet jacks to make pushing and pulling objects easier and safer.
